EDMONTON -- If poor Richard Plantaganet - better known as Richard III - could withstand 400 years of Shakespearean defamation he would probably get a kick out of Hump!, an ingenious send-up from Panties Productions now playing at the New Varscona.
History tells us (despite the Shakespearean hatchet job) that Richard III was probably no worse than any other English king of the period but the Bard needed a misshapen villain, "cheated of feature by dissembling nature, deform'd, unfinish'd, sent before my time into this breathing world, scarce half-made up.''
